Question
Find the Axial Forces in members 1 - 5.
Find the Displacement Displacement of joint A (mm, positive right and up) for both Horizontal and Vertical

Transcribed Image Text:Analyse the pin-jointed truss illustrated below, finding the member forces using the matrix stiffness
method. The pinned connections are designated by yellow circles. The members are only connected at
these points. EA is 250000 kN for all members. a = 3 m, b = 5 m, c = 3 m, and d = 2 m. P = 7 kN.
